Sanofi focuses on long-term growth as a global healthcare leader
Veröffentlicht: 07.07.2026 um 09:33 Uhr, Redaktion AD HOC NEWS, Redaktionelle Verantwortung: Rafael Müller (Chefredaktion)Sanofi S.A. (ISIN FR0000127771) is one of Europe's largest healthcare companies, with a broad portfolio that spans prescription medicines, vaccines and consumer health products. The group is headquartered in France and listed in its home market, giving investors exposure to a diversified pharmaceutical business with a global footprint. The company has built its strategy around innovation in specialty care and immunology alongside a long-standing presence in vaccines.
Global pharmaceutical profile
Sanofi operates across multiple therapeutic areas, including oncology, immunology, diabetes, cardiovascular disease and rare diseases. Its prescription medicines segment includes biologic therapies and traditional small-molecule drugs, reflecting a balance between new pipeline assets and established treatments. In recent years, management has emphasized specialty care, where complex conditions and unmet medical needs can support longer product lifecycles.
The group generates revenue from both developed and emerging markets, serving patients through hospital channels, retail pharmacies and institutional buyers. This geographic and commercial spread helps reduce dependence on any single country or product line. For investors, the breadth of Sanofi's portfolio provides exposure to different stages of the pharmaceutical value chain, from early research to mature brands.
Research-driven innovation focus
Research and development are central to Sanofi's long-term growth strategy. The company allocates significant resources to clinical trials and early-stage research to identify novel therapies, particularly in immunology and oncology. This focus aims to build a pipeline that can replace or complement existing medicines as they move through their lifecycle.
Sanofi's development activities typically span multiple phases, from pre-clinical work to large-scale Phase III trials and post-approval studies. The company collaborates with scientific institutions and uses internal expertise to advance drug candidates through regulatory review. For patients, successful development can mean new treatment options where existing therapies are limited.
Business segments and diversification
Sanofi's operations are broadly organized into prescription medicines, vaccines and consumer health products. The prescription medicines segment contributes a substantial portion of revenue and includes treatments for chronic and acute conditions. This segment often requires continued investment in lifecycle management, such as new indications or formulation improvements.
The vaccines business provides immunization solutions for a wide range of diseases, supporting public health programs and commercial markets. Vaccine demand can be influenced by national immunization strategies and global health initiatives, making this segment an important contributor to both revenue and reputation. Consumer health products, including over-the-counter medicines and wellness items, add an additional line of business with different pricing and regulatory dynamics than prescription drugs.
